I really think it got bad when I found the Julep website and became a Julep Maven. How that works is you take a quiz to find out what your style profile is (Boho Glam, Bombshell, It Girl or Classic With a Twist), then according to your style, colors are chosen for you and shipped once a month but you don't have to stick with your profile colors, you can switch profiles if you want. There is a huge variety of colors and finishes but the best part is the polishes are "4-free" and does not contain formaldehyde, formaldehyde resin, toluene or DBP. Also, the owner and CEO Jane Park has a program called Powered by Girlfriends in that a percentage of the proceeds from the sale of every Julep nail color is donated to organizations that empower women.
